Massive funding of 3 billion rubles allocated for restoration and renovation of educational institutions
In the Kuban region, a significant overhaul of dining facilities in schools has been underway, with 45 schools receiving comprehensive renovations. This initiative forms part of a larger project, where repairs have been carried out in 685 educational institutions, with a total of 3 billion rubles allocated for this purpose.
The renovation project covers schools, kindergartens, colleges, and centres for additional education across the region. Before the start of the new academic year, over 3,200 educational institutions in Kuban were inspected to ensure they meet the necessary standards.
According to Anna Minykov, Vice-Governor of Kuban, the inspections and renovations have been ongoing, with updates regularly shared on her Telegram channel. The main focus of this project is to create comfortable conditions for every child in the region, ensuring they have a safe and inviting learning environment.
